I've got the 6" split in the front door pot and they sounded really good for a 149 bucks. 6.5" doesn't fit, too big !!!! With the 6" all you have to do is to cut the plastic cone inside which hold the speakers. To cut the cone, I used a thin blade with a pair of pliers, heated it up on the stove and apply. You don't even need to drill any holes all the screws are lined up.

I think you'll find the clearance for speakers in the doors on VR/VS to their pods is very tight for some reason. Some speakers will fit and some wont. Can't remember if its 'some 6.5" speakers will fit' or only 'some 6" speakers will fit". My JL's do not fit, and they are 6.5", but I have mounted them differently so that I do not have to modify the speaker pods.

Theres also a possibility that the response speakers have a large magnet that doesnt quite fit dept-wise into the pods. They are quite shallow and all speakers are different except for their standard mounting hole spacing.
